THREE hairdressers proved they are a cut above the rest by raising thousands of pounds for Frimley Health Charity’s Breast Care Appeal.
Nina Warden, Tracy Taplin and Sharon Lloyd held a ‘Be Beautiful Party Night’, which was attended by 130 people. The evening was opened by breast surgeon Isabella Karat and raised £3,664 for the appeal to equip a dedicated breast unit at Frimley Park Hospital.
The three organisers later visited the hospital to present a giant cheque. Nina, owner of Be Beautiful Hair and Beauty, said: “We all know someone who has been affected by this terrible illness and wanted to do our best to help.
“The venue and the band, The Velvet Underwriters, did an amazing job and we received so many messages afterwards saying what a great night everyone had.
“We reached out to local businesses for donations to our luxury raffle and were overwhelmed at their generosity. We couldn’t have achieved half of what we did without the support from local companies, friends and families alike.”
Frimley Health Charity’s Breast Care appeal is aiming to raise £750,000 by October this year. Frimley Health NHS Foundation Trust, which runs Frimley Park Hospital, will match every pound raised up to £750,000, creating a £1.5m investment for a 3D mammography machine and dedicated unit for the 6,000 people who use the hospital’s breast services every year.
